#4745d0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4745d0 is composed of 27.8% red, 27.1%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.9% cyan, 66.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 240.9 degrees, a saturation of 59.7% and a lightness of 54.3%. #4745d0 color hex could be obtained by blending #8e8aff with #0000a1.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#4745d0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4745d0 has RGB values of R:71, G:69,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.67,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 4670928.
